I have a Dual Relay Board 3051_1B, and have wired it with a HUB0000_0.

I have:
- One VINT port hooked up to the 3051's 3-pin connector via a Phidget cable
- Two VINT ports sending digital output to 3051's Control 0 and Control 1.

I know the 3051's 3-pin connector is used to power the board (red wire) and provide a ground (black wire). What is the white wire used for?

I see in the 3051's User Guide, it's connected to an analog input. However, when I energize/deenergize the relay, the analog input doesn't pick up a signal.

Can you confirm the white wire is unused?

for the 3051, the white wire isn't hooked up to anything. The device is connected to the analog input purely for providing power to the relays.
